Add manager context
Open Overview and select Add your details. You can also open Manager chat from Case actions. Explain the continuity risks, the intended successor or temporary owner, and which work must not be interrupted.
Ask the employee to contribute
Select Send employee link in Overview, enter the employee's email, and select Send link. Check the address before sending. Tell the employee which responsibilities matter most and when the information is needed.
Share the contributor guide if they need examples of a useful answer.
Involve colleagues
In the case's Users tab, select Add user, enter the email, and choose the appropriate case role. Use colleagues who can fill specific gaps rather than inviting the whole organization.
To request knowledge by email, select eligible participants in the table and use the envelope control labelled Collect knowledge over email. Confirm with Send emails. If the control is disabled, check that you selected an eligible participant and have permission to manage the case.
Check what was captured
Read Case knowledge to see the case sections. Look for missing routines, unclear ownership, unexplained links, and unresolved risks. A link to a runbook is most useful when the answer also says when to use it and what is different today.
Use AI review to focus the next round of questions. This turns employee knowledge transfer into a reviewable process rather than a one-time request for a document.
